Guys I have to say, I think this is an A plus trade for Kyle Dubas and the Penguins. The fact that you were able to convince the Canucks to give you a first round pick, whether it be this year or next year, is huge.
I would've hoped for at least a second, a first is massive. They got a first, a prospect, and two NHL roster players who I think will be decent. You get a defenseman in Vincent Desharnais, who I really liked when he played for the Edmonton Oilers last season. He's a right handed d-man, which is a plus and he adds a little bit of size to the Pens blue line at 6'6 and Danton Heinen is a decent bottom 6 forward who is probably good on average for 8-12 goals, although he is streaky and can put up outbursts as we saw here in Pittsburgh 3 years ago when he contributed 18 goals. He knows this organization from just playing here two seasons ago, so he will probably fit right back in.
I love this trade overall, sad to see the Dragon go, but he fetched a pretty nice return I would say.

Basically the Rangers 1st round pick for Marcus Pettersson. The salaries are a wash. MP is $4.025,175AAV. Desharnais is $2AAV and Heinen is $2.25AAV. Both have 1 year deals and Desharnais can be traded next deadline as he is a big right shot defense man.
